Related occupations
Explore related occupations in the it manager sector.
QA Tester
A QA Tester ensures software quality by creating test plans, identifying defects, and performing manual and automated testing to meet standards and client expectations.
Software Tester
A Software Tester ensures software quality by performing tests, designing test plans, documenting results, and collaborating with developers.
Help Desk Support
Help Desk Support Technicians provide technical support for hardware and software, troubleshoot issues, and assist users via various communication channels.
Service Desk Analyst
Service Desk Analysts troubleshoot software and hardware issues, providing technical support via phone, chat, and email for various organisations.
Systems Administrator
System Administrators manage daily operations of computer networks, configuring and maintaining systems, training users, and troubleshooting issues.
Network Administrator
Network Administrators install, manage, and upgrade networks, troubleshoot issues, set up users, and maintain system security and passwords.
IT Technician
An IT Technician troubleshoots, repairs, and maintains computer systems, working in-person or remotely, requiring strong technical and customer service skills.
Computer Technician
A Computer Technician diagnoses and repairs IT equipment, installs systems, consults clients, and ensures maintenance while providing customer service.
IT Support Officer
An IT Support Officer resolves IT issues, guides clients, performs repairs, provides remote or in-person support, and recommends software solutions.
ICT Support Engineer
An ICT Support Engineer ensures an organisation's IT infrastructure runs smoothly by diagnosing and resolving issues, configuring systems, and providing training to staff.
IT Specialist
An IT Specialist manages technology infrastructure, troubleshooting issues, ensuring system security, and providing user support to maintain efficiency.
Cloud Support Technician
A Cloud Support Technician helps manage cloud-based systems, ensuring they run smoothly and efficiently for users and businesses.
